Comprehending Chest Freezer Sizes
Chest freezers been available in a variety of sizes, usually classified according to their storage capacity determined in cubic feet (cu. ft.). Common sizes range from compact, small freezers perfect for smaller homes to larger ones that can accommodate bulk purchases for families or long-lasting storage.
Why Choose a Chest Freezer?
Before diving into size specifics, let's briefly explore why a chest freezer can be advantageous:
Energy Efficiency: Chest freezers tend to be more energy-efficient than upright models, consuming less power with time.Storage Space: With a wide interior decoration, chest freezers allow for maximum storage flexibility, accommodating bigger items that may not fit in an upright.Temperature level Retention: Because of their design, chest freezers preserve cold temperatures longer throughout power failures compared to upright freezers.Chest Freezer Size Table

Picking the right Cheap Chest Freezer freezer includes considering numerous aspects, including:
Available Space: Measure the location where you plan to position the freezer to ensure an appropriate fit. Likewise, think about clearance for doors and air flow.
Storage Needs: Assess your typical grocery buying practices. Do you buy in bulk, or do you prefer shopping more regularly? Larger families usually require more storage space.
Energy Efficiency: Larger freezers often take in more energy. Consider your electricity budget and the performance ranking of the freezer you're thinking about.
Bonus offers and Drawbacks: Remember that larger systems typically have more capability however can be much heavier and harder to move. Smaller sized designs can be more easily transportable however have limited storage.
FAQs on Chest Freezer Sizes
Q1: What is the ideal size for a chest freezer for a family of four?
A1: Generally, a medium to large chest freezer, varying from 9.1 to 20.0 cubic feet, is appropriate for a family of four. This size can accommodate weekly bulk purchases and seasonal fruit and vegetables.
Q2: How do I measure the area for a chest freezer?
A2: To determine, use a measuring tape to get the length, width, and height of the area where you plan to place the freezer. Don't forget to represent space around it for air flow and access to the door.

Q4: How much do chest freezers typically cost?
A4: Depending on size and features, chest freezers can vary from roughly ₤ 200 to ₤ 1,200. The more compact designs tend to be at the lower end, while high-capacity systems might cost considerably more.
Q5: Should I pick a manual defrost or a frost-free model?
A5: Manual thaw models tend to be cheaper and typically have much better energy performance. Nevertheless, Frost Free Chest Freezer-free models are simpler to keep as they prevent ice buildup immediately. Consider your convenience and upkeep choices when choosing.
